I am looking to attach some plywood to the top of my bench seats to then in turn attach boxes I have made to raise the height of my swivel boat seat. I have tried butterfly anchors and am wondering if there are any other mechanical fasteners out there that would work or should i go with gorilla glue or something?? Please help!!
 
Blind rivets (pop) will work well.

It's what I used to fasten my 3/4" decking in my boat.

These will work for 5/8":

https://www.rivetsonline.com/index.php?dispatch=checkout.cart

I selected the 3/16 diameter for you so you can install them with a regular rivet setting tool.

Installing them on 6" centers around the perimeter of your piece of plywood will make for a rock solid installation. Installing your plywood like this will make for an easily removable installation unlike gluing.

These rivets come in many different diameters and lengths.

Most home centers don't carry the different diameters and lengths that we need for boat building. Your best bet to find them locally would be Fastenal or Grainger.

You select these rivets by the grip range you need, for 5/8" ply and the thickness of your boat seat I selected the .626-.750 (5/8-3/4") grip. I wouldn't recommend anything less than 5/8" thickness for your application.
